AnnualCreditReport.com usually provides a free credit report once every 12 months, but due to the COVID-19 pandemic, the site is currently offering free weekly credit reports to anyone who signs up until December 2022.

What is AnnualCreditReport.com?
The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au and the Federal Trade Commission (www.FTC.gov) officially recognize AnnualCreditReport.com. It’s the only site that is obligated under federal law — the Fair Credit Reporting Act — to provide users with a free credit report from:
- Equifax
- Experian
- TransUnion
